Enter the sender and destination e-mail addresses in the From: and To: fields. You can enter multiple destination addresses separated by commas. The From: and To: addresses can be the same. Many SMTP servers check if the sender address is a valid one, others let you fill in anything you want. If you get any errors in the logfile saying something like "we do not relay", the SMTP server does not accept the sender address.
You also need to enter the (dns) name or IP address of a valid SMTP server.

KIU can monitor the memory and disk resources of your Mac. If free memory
or disk space falls below a certain preset level, it will alarm you by sending
an e-mail notification and creating an entry in the KIU log file.
You can enable this feature in the preferences menu:
Note: the free memory check is currently not implemented
in Keep-It-Up-X 3.0, enabling it will have no effect.
The checks are repeated about every 5 minutes. When one or more alarms are triggered, KIU will send an e-mail message for each alarm. It will then stop sending messages during the period you entered as notification interval. After this period, the same or new alarms can be triggered again.
